The scope of legal protection for listed buildings
This List entry helps identify the building designated at this address for its special architectural or historic interest.
Unless the List entry states otherwise, it includes both the structure itself and any object or structure fixed to it (whether inside or outside) as well as any object or structure within the curtilage of the building.
For these purposes, to be included within the curtilage of the building, the object or structure must have formed part of the land since before 1st July 1948.

Details
PLYMOUTH
SX4753 GRAND PARADE, Hoe, West
740-1/66/315 West Hoe Pier
01/05/75
(Formerly Listed as:
GRAND PARADE, Plymouth
West Hoe Pier)
GV II
Piers and walls enclosing basin. 1880 datestone. Plymouth
limestone rubble brought to course. Irregular plan basin with
retaining wall to the landward side, short shaped return walls
and 2 jetties approximately parallel to the shore with harbour
entrance between. Steps with landings: broad flight mid-way to
shore wall, another to the right-hand wall on the seaward side
and 3 flights of recessed steps to the jetties, a seaward
flight to each jetty and an inner flight to the right-hand
jetty.
